What to Look for in Best Blue and White Asian Vase

Evaluate Porcelain Quality

Look for smooth, non-porous glaze and crisp, deep cobalt pigment that won't fade over time.

Check Scale and Proportion

Ensure the visual weight of the vase complements your console table without overwhelming smaller decorative vignettes.

Inspect Hand-Painted Details

Authentic pieces often feature intricate brushwork that adds unique character compared to mass-produced printed decals.

Consider Versatile Shapes

A classic ginger jar silhouette offers timeless appeal, while slender neck vases provide a more modern, minimalist aesthetic.

Assess Base Stability

Always verify the weighted base to prevent tipping, especially when displaying long-stemmed florals or dried branches.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I style a blue and white vase?

Pair your vase with neutral textures like linen or wood to let the blue patterns pop. Grouping items in odd numbers creates a professional, curated look on any tabletop.

Are these vases food safe?

Most decorative porcelain vases are not food-safe due to the lead content in older glazes. Use them strictly for floral displays or as standalone art pieces.

How do I clean my porcelain vase?

Gently wipe the exterior with a soft, damp microfiber c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als that could dull the high-gloss finish of the glaze.

Will these vases fit a farmhouse aesthetic?

Absolutely, these pieces provide a beautiful contrast to rustic wood furniture. The clean lines of a ginger jar bridge the gap between traditional elegance and cozy farmhouse charm.

What is the difference between Chinoiserie and standard blue and white?

Chinoiserie refers to the European interpretation of East Asian artistic traditions. It often features more whimsical, narrative-driven illustrations compared to traditional Ming-style patterns.

Can I use these outdoors?

Porcelain is generally frost-sensitive and can crack in extreme temperatures. It is best to keep these pieces indoors to protect the integrity of the ceramic body.
